Subject: Scanner integration rollout — Marrowden v4.2

Hi all,

The Brightlark barcode scanner integration ships in tonight's release. New contractors: please note the scanner module now negotiates firmware capability before each session, so older handhelds fall back to camera mode automatically. Test against both paths before sign-off, and log any decode failures with full payloads in the release channel. The candidate build you should verify is identified by the token below.

session token of yajof-bagef = htk4_937d

The site currently houses nine staff, all of whom will be offered relocation to the Marrowfield hub or remote arrangements. Lease termination is targeted for end of Q2, pending landlord negotiation. IT decommissioning and records transfer will be coordinated by Facilities, with a two-week overlap period for mail and courier redirection. Department heads should brief affected teams only after HR confirms individual arrangements. The confidential rationale follows below.

management briefing: Project Ulavan slips by two quarters because of the staffing delay.

# Break-Glass: Build Agent Clock Skew

When agents in the Tarnwick build pool drift more than 90 seconds, signed artifact timestamps fail verification and the Quillstone pipeline halts. Break-glass access lets an authorized reviewer force-resync NTP on all agents. Use sparingly; every invocation is logged to the Ashgrove ledger. To unlock the resync console, enter the passphrase below.

recovery phrase for bawef-haduf: wenax-druox-julmir

Records team: trophies for the Ferncliff Awards Night go to Gildmark's workshop Tuesday, return Thursday. Verify engraving list against the master roster before release — no corrections possible after Wednesday noon. Count: 14 trophies, 3 plaques. Pack in foam crates, lids latched, crate tags logged. Workshop will not accept unlisted items. Return leg uses the same courier, Larchway Express. Note any damage on the manifest immediately. The restricted hand-over instruction for the courier appears directly below.

dispatch memo: the quenax olidor courier leaves the lamvan aldath keliel ledger at gate 2085 under passcode 005795